Preparation

Place the egg yolks in a bowl with two tablespoons of sugar, setting aside the two egg whites. Beat the egg yolks and sugar with a whisk, add the warm melted butter, sift in the flour and the yeast, and then add the milk until you have a smooth but thick batter. Beat the egg whites until stiff, then fold into the batter evenly and let it rest for about 30 minutes. Meanwhile, peel and core the apples, and cut into 1 cm thick slices. Place them in a shallow bowl, sprinkle with the remaining sugar and drizzle with brandy. Heat the oil, dip the apple slices in the batter with a wooden skewer and fry in the hot oil a few at a time. Brown them on both sides, drain on absorbent paper and, once cool, sprinkle with icing sugar.

Tips
Once the apple fritters are fried, put them on paper towels to remove all excess oil; when frying them, make sure they are well separated to prevent them from sticking. Also, sprinkle sugar over them while they are still hot, and if you want to give them an extra twist, add some powdered spice such as cinnamon.
Trivia
These apple fritters are a specialty of the region of Trentino Alto Adige, prepared during Carnival with the fruit that sums up the area: apples. In Trentino they grow many different varieties: Golden Delicious, Gala, Winesap, Morgenduft, Fuji and Braeburn, Granny Smith, Renetta and Canada.

Apple and Raisin Carnival Fritters

Another delicious idea is to prepare Apple Carnival fritters by adding raisins. Apple and raisin Carnival fritters are equally appreciated as long as you like raisins. In general, raisins always pair very well with apples. However, be sure to treat the raisins with the necessary care. Among these, remember to soak the raisins in warm water for a few minutes so that they plump up. If you are in a hurry, you can skip this step. If you enjoy the aroma of brandy or marsala, add a little to your soaking water. But only if there are no children around. If there are children in the house, do not use alcohol but soak the raisins in just warm water. Also, before adding the raisins to the batter, squeeze them very well. 

Chunky Apple Fritters

If you want to prepare Apple Carnival fritters but do not have an apple corer and find it complicated to get regular apple slices, we recommend making chunky apple fritters. To do this, cut regular-sized pieces of apple. However, do not make them too large. The frying would become difficult and complicated, and the apple fritters would be hard on the inside. Even if you make chunky apple fritters, do not exceed a thickness of half a centimeter!

Puffed Apple Fritters

How to make puffed apple fritters? Well, it takes a few more minutes and a bit of patience, but the result is definitely pleasant to the palate and taste. You will need, as suggested in the recipe, to separate the yolks from the egg whites and then whip the egg whites until stiff peaks form. Only at this point will you incorporate them into the batter. This way, the Apple Carnival fritters will be very puffy and fluffy.
